How to Choose the Right Backcountry Inflator
Selecting an inflator requires an honest assessment of tire size and usage frequency. Larger tires require high-CFM compressors, while small, occasional adjustments can be handled by lower-powered units. Overestimating needs leads to unnecessary weight; underestimating leads to trail-side frustration.
Consider the heat cycles of the unit before committing. A compressor that overheats after inflating one tire is a liability, not an asset. Always verify that the duty cycle matches the workload expected for your specific vehicle and climate.
- Check the Duty Cycle: Look for a rating of 50% or higher if you plan on inflating multiple tires at once.
- Assess Power Limits: Ensure your vehicle’s 12V outlet can handle the amperage required by the compressor.
- Verify Hose Length: Ensure the hose can reach the furthest tire from the power source without being stretched taut.
Power Options: 12V vs Battery vs Direct Wire
Direct-wire systems, which attach directly to the battery terminals, offer the most consistent and powerful performance. They bypass the limitations of weak accessory fuses found in most vehicle cockpits. This is the preferred method for anyone running tires over 33 inches.
Battery-operated inflators provide unparalleled portability but remain limited by runtime and charge state. They are excellent for minor adjustments but struggle with high-volume, continuous work.
12V accessory plug (cigarette lighter) units are the easiest to install but often suffer from lower amperage limits. They are best reserved for smaller tires or emergency-only scenarios where speed is secondary to portability.
Airing Down and Up for Different Trail Types
Airing down is not just for rock crawling; it increases the tire’s footprint, providing better traction on soft sand, deep snow, and gravel. By dropping pressure, the tire carcass conforms to obstacles, preventing punctures and smoothing out the ride for both the vehicle and the passengers.
When the terrain transitions back to pavement, airing up is non-negotiable. Driving at highway speeds on under-inflated tires generates excessive heat, leading to sidewall failure or unpredictable handling.
Always maintain an accurate, high-quality tire pressure gauge separate from the one on the inflator. Digital gauges are precise, but analog gauges are more resistant to extreme temperature fluctuations. Consistent pressure management is a core skill for preserving both your tires and your drivetrain.
Compressor Care and Maintenance on the Trail
Moisture is the silent killer of portable compressors. After using a unit in humid or wet conditions, allow it to run for a few seconds without a load to clear internal condensation. Store the compressor in a dry, dust-proof bag to prevent grit from fouling the intake valves.
Keep the air filter clean, especially if you spend time in silty or sandy environments. A clogged filter forces the motor to work harder, accelerating wear and increasing the likelihood of an overheat shutdown.
- Inspect Hoses: Periodically check for cracks or dry rot, especially near the fittings where stress is highest.
- Check Electrical Leads: Ensure alligator clamps remain free of corrosion to maintain a solid electrical connection.
- Storage: Always store the unit in an upright position to keep the internal piston seals properly oriented.
